Who is King Croaker?

King Croaker, a formidable frog-like boss in AFK Journey’s Dream Realm, presents a unique challenge. He boasts powerful attacks, notably tank-busting abilities that can quickly decimate high-durability characters. His considerable AoE skills require constant healing to prevent team wipes. This guide details the best strategies to overcome him.

  • Magic Bubble: Instakill attacks that hit every 15, 35, and 55 seconds, requiring robust healing strategies.
  • Magic Barrier: His ultimate ability, a powerful energy shield that increases in intensity with his level, significantly reducing incoming damage.
  • Water Bomb: A devastating AoE attack that targets clustered units, highlighting the importance of strategic positioning.
  • Knockback: A melee swipe that knocks back and stuns units for a short duration, necessitating team positioning and awareness.

King Croaker prioritizes tanks and ranged damage. Strategically placing tanks at different ranges, ensuring they are distanced from primary units to minimize the impact of AoE attacks, is crucial for success.
